July 26, 1871 — the Pskov uyezd zemstvo post was opened. Its tasks included the delivery of official and private correspondence, which was dispatched twice a week from the uyezd center to 18 zemstvo postal stations. Payment for the delivery of private mail items was made with zemstvo postage stamps. The stamps were cancelled in ink by crossing them out. Postal handstamps of various sizes and shapes were also used for cancellation.
